Turkey and cranberry sausage rolls

Prep Time:
3 minutes
Cook Time:
40 minutes
Total Time:
43 minutes
Elevate Christmas sausage rolls with gourmet turkey and tangy cranberry sauce.
Ingredients:
  • 3 slices white bread, crusts removed, roughly chopped
  • 1kg turkey mince
  • 3 green onions, finely sliced
  • 146.25 gm whole cranberry sauce
  • 75g camembert cheese, finely chopped
  • 4 sheets frozen ready-rolled puff pastry, partially thawed
  • 1 egg, lightly beaten
Instructions:
  • Preheat the oven to 180°C and grease 2 baking trays. In a bowl, soak the bread with 1/4 cup of water, let it sit for 3 minutes, then drain and squeeze out excess water.
  • In a large bowl, mix together bread, mince, onions, cranberry sauce, camembert,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  • Divide the pastry sheet in half. Spread 3/4 cup of turkey mixture along one long edge of the pastry. Moisten the opposite edge with water, then roll it up tightly to seal. Cut the roll into 5 smaller pieces. Score three lines on the top of each piece using a sharp knife. Transfer the rolls onto the baking tray. Repeat the process with the rest of the turkey mixture and pastry.
  • Coat rolls with beaten egg and season generously with sea salt flakes and pepper. Bake for 40-45 minutes until beautifully golden and fully cooked. Serve warm.
